Biography

Oliver Battle was a Georgian.
Oliver Battle is related to US President Jimmy Carter. Here is the trail.

Oliver Lazarus Battle was born on 2 Mar 1819 in Madison, Morgan County, Georgia, son of Lazarus Battle (1777 - 1824) and Margaret (Porter) King ( - <1837).

His siblings were:

  1. Martha (Battle) Gilbert (~1802 - ~1880)
  2. Eliza (Fannin) Walker (1815 - 1867)

Oliver married Martha Sappington Irvin (1821 - 1908)

Oliver died on 5 Mar 1886 in Waco, McLennan, Texas, United States aged 67.

O. L. Battle and Sophia Carter

Oliver had a relationship with Sophia Carter (~1813 - ) Their children were:

  1. Sarah (Carter) Bankston (1837 - 1922)
  2. Charles Carter (~1843 - <1910)
  3. Martha (Carter) Shorter (~1844 - 1928)
  4. Willis Carter (~1845 - ~1899)
  5. Sophia Carter (~1846 - <1900)
  6. Priscilla Carter (~1847 - 1927).

1820 Census

Lararus Battle [Lazarus Battle] Home in 1820 (City, County, State): Madison, Morgan, Georgia Enumeration Date: August 7, 1820 Free White Persons - Males - Under 10: 1 Free White Persons - Males - 26 thru 44: 1 Free White Persons - Females - Under 10: 2 Free White Persons - Females - 10 thru 15: 4 Free White Persons - Females - 16 thru 25: 1 Free White Persons - Females - 26 thru 44: 1 Slaves - Males - Under 14: 9 Slaves - Males - 14 thru 25: 7 Slaves - Males - 26 thru 44: 4 Slaves - Females - Under 14: 9 Slaves - Females - 14 thru 25: 5 Slaves - Females - 26 thru 44: 4 Slaves - Females - 45 and over: 1 Number of Persons - Engaged in Agriculture: 12 Free White Persons - Under 16: 7 Free White Persons - Over 25: 2 Total Free White Persons: 10 Total Slaves: 39 Total All Persons - White, Slaves, Colored, Other: 49 [1]
